In this episode we have Jan Meyer, Senior Vice President and Global Head of Learning Systems at SAP. Jan shares the evolution of SAP product learning over the years, he highlights the updates and latest news in SAP Learning Hub and looks into the future of SAP Product Learning.
SAP Product Learning has transformed from merely classroom-based to a blended, flexible to consume learning offering with different elements like digital self-paced, collaborative or instructor led learning.
Jan describes the different drivers like the emergence of cloud and SaaS software and thus the need to scale and speed up learning and skill-development. Jan notes that digital and virtual learning methods have a wider reach due to their flexibility and 24/7 availability, although traditional methods remain important. He cites examples of professionals causing problems in projects due to outdated product knowledge.
In the beginning of 2024 there were different changes in SAP Learning Hub, the platform for digital SAP Training.
The SAP Learning Hub 2024 is now offering an enhanced, optimized learning experience and a simplified, cost-optimized purchase. The goal is to scale learning and making learning for SAP software solutions more accessible to SAP customers and partners.

This complements the proven elements like learning content in different languages, collaboration in learning rooms or the offers to stay current and certified with regular assessments and learning contents.
On learning.sap.com, a single place for SAP product learning content consisting of text, videos or self-assessments is now available for free. The content was redesigned for a digital-first experience. It is simple to access, simple to find and made modular and thus the free start. The SAP Learning Hub remains as SAP's premium learning offering with all the above mentioned elements.
Jan Meyer highlights also the decision to connect the learning site with the SAP Community for asynchronous collaborative learning.
The goal is to make the learning experience more efficient, scalable, and personal.
In the third part of the podcast Jan Meyer shares his ideas on the future developments for SAP's learning experience. He emphasizes the importance of the primary destination for all SAP product learning. So for example openSAP is also in the process to migrate to the SAP Learning site. He also mentions the ongoing transformation of SAP's certification process to become more role-based, aligning with the real-life roles of learners in their ecosystem. Jan also highlights the potential of AI. A benefit for example lies in creating and translating more content, and this could help the learning organization do more and do it faster. Finally, he briefly mentions the bridge between learning and workforce management as a growing trend, and the use of AI to provide personalized learning journeys.
Jan also shares his narrative for learning and training.
"We see clearly that learning adds significant business value through the entire customer value journey, from the buying phase to the implementation and adoption phase, and then through the consumption phase ..... So we clearly see that learning adds significant business value"
